Your itinerary.
Goa Arrival — Beach Check-in
Arrive at Goa airport or railway station, transfer to your beach resort at Baga and spend the evening by the sand.
North Goa — Baga & Fort Aguada
Morning at Baga and Calangute beaches, visit Fort Aguada, then an afternoon of water sports (jet ski, parasailing, banana boat).
Old Goa & South Goa
Visit the Basilica of Bom Jesus and Old Goa churches in the morning, then drive down to Palolem beach. Evening sunset cruise.
Departure
Leisure morning at the resort, then transfer to the airport or railway station for your onward journey.

Getting there & ideal duration
Ideal duration
3–4 days
From Sikar
Flight recommended (Sikar → Delhi/ Jaipur → Goa)
By Air
Dabolim (GOI) and Mopa (GOX) airports — direct flights from Delhi, Mumbai and Bengaluru.
By Rail
Madgaon station — direct trains from Delhi (Rajdhani) and Mumbai.
By Road
≈ 1,700 km from Sikar; cab or bus via Mumbai (Konkan route).
